If you decide to make a claim, it is with the CCTS.  The CRTC is another avenue for consumer inquiries but not for disputes with a carrier which is handled by the CCTS.  Bear in mind, the process for making a claim requires that you discuss your differences with the carrier in an attempt to reach an amicable resolution.  Failing that, you file a complaint that include evidence of past discussions.  This is covered by a knowledge base article.

This is incorrect.  A plan that has been dorment for 90 days of inactive service is unable to be reactivated.  If it has been less than 90 days, it can be reactivated, normally without issue.

 

It does seem odd that this has happened, and a moderator should not have done a plan change of any type without explicit content from the account holder.

 

Of course it is ideal if everyone would just continue paying for their no longer in market plan, but with the 90 day grace period offered, there is no requirement to force it.
